Who is Jean-François Baldé?

Jean-François Baldé is a former Grand Prix motorcycle road racer from France. His best year was in 1981 when he won the Argentine Grand Prix and finished in second place in the 250cc world championship behind Anton Mang. He won three races in 1982 riding for Kawasaki and ended the season ranked third in the 350 class. Baldé won five Grand Prix races during his career.
